USA Movies 

The United States of America is a leading producer of movies and is known for its Hollywood film industry. Some popular movie genres in the USA include action, comedy, drama, horror, and science fiction. Some famous American movies include "The Godfather," "Star Wars," "The Shawshank Redemption," "Forrest Gump," "The Dark Knight," "Titanic," "Jurassic Park," "The Matrix," and "Avatar," among many others.


India Movies

India has a vibrant film industry, commonly referred to as Bollywood, based in Mumbai. Indian movies are known for their colorful dance sequences, melodious music, and dramatic storylines. The movies are made in various languages, including Hindi, Tamil, Telugu, and others. Some famous Indian movies include "Sholay," "Dilwale Dulhania Le Jayenge," "Baahubali," "Lagaan," "Kabhi Khushi Kabhie Gham," "3 Idiots," "Mughal-E-Azam," and "Mother India," among many others.


China Movies

China has a thriving film industry and is known for producing movies in various genres, including martial arts, historical epics, and romantic dramas. Some famous Chinese movies include "Crouching Tiger, Hidden Dragon," "Raise the Red Lantern," "To Live," "Farewell My Concubine," "Hero," "House of Flying Daggers," "The Grandmaster," and "Wolf Warrior," among many others. The film industry in China is concentrated in the cities of Beijing, Shanghai, and Hong Kong.


UK Movies

The United Kingdom has a rich film history, and its movies are known for their focus on character development, social commentary, and subtle humor. Some famous British movies include "Lawrence of Arabia," "A Clockwork Orange," "The Bridge on the River Kwai," "The Third Man," "The Queen," "Four Weddings and a Funeral," "Trainspotting," and "Shaun of the Dead," among many others. The UK is also home to several prestigious film schools and is a popular location for filming Hollywood movies.

Japan Movies

Japan has a rich cinematic tradition, and its movies are known for their unique blend of emotion, storytelling, and visual style. Some famous Japanese movies include "Seven Samurai," "Rashomon," "Spirited Away," "Akira," "Godzilla," "Tokyo Story," "Your Name," and "Battle Royale," among many others. Japan is also home to several renowned animation studios, including Studio Ghibli, which has produced many beloved animated movies. The Japnese film industry is concentrated in Tokyo and is known for producing movies in various genres, including samurai epics, horror, and anime.
